ASOS

ASOS was founded in 2000 with the fashion-conscious shopper in their 20s as its target audience. The company initially raised funds through the sale of cheap replicas of clothes worn by celebrities such as Sienna Miller and Kate Moss. But a year later, the founders Nick Robertson and Susanne Clarke decided to concentrate solely on clothing, as it would yield the highest returns.

The ASOS website has a variety of products and sizes, including maternity clothes plus-size clothes, accessories such as shoes and stationary. The ASOS website also provides a variety of fashion guides, #AsSeenOnMe and other content that could help inspire. Customers can add items to a wish list and create private boards to organize their favorite items.

The mobile app of ASOS offers an effortless shopping experience with saved items sync and quick checkout. The app also displays inventory information, which can help to avoid disappointment when items are not in stock. George at ASDA

Founded in 1989, George is the Asda's grocery fashion brand that offers clothes for women, men and children. The brand offers a range of clothing that is priced affordably and ethically made. Customers can shop online, at over 500 Asda stores, as well as on the George website.

The new collection is a part of the 'quiet luxury' trend, featuring pieces made from silk, cotton, and linen blends. The line includes slouchy suiting as well as ribbed knit separates and printed co-ords. Prices start at 12 pounds for a 100 percent Supima cotton T-shirt and rise up to 77 pounds for full suits.

Debenhams

Debenhams is one of the UK's most historic department store chains, which offers a wide range of clothing and other items. It also features a great selection of brands and has regular sales and discounts. In addition, the company offers various services to help customers locate what they're searching for.

The retailer began operations in 1778 as a draper's business in London. Through the years, it has evolved into a large chain of department stores with an international presence. It is a leading fashion retailer, known for its exclusive brands and designer clothes. It also has a large online presence.

While a few Debenhams stores have shut down during the COVID-19 epidemic, it continues to operate online. The company recently sold its brand and website to Boohoo Group for PS55 million. The purchase highlights the growing power shift away from brick and mortar retailers to their more agile online counterparts. This trend is likely to continue as sales at physical stores continue to fall.

BooHoo

Boohoo, an online retailer of fast fashions based in Manchester was established in 2006 by Mahmud Kane and Carol Kane. It has customers in over 100 countries. Its own fashion clothing brand is developed and manufactured in the United Kingdom. The company also sells other brands, like Pretty Little Thing and Miss Pap.

The business model of the brand is based on maximising profits by selling to young people seeking trendy and new clothes at affordable prices. This market segment, which is comprised of those who are less than 30 years old, represents a large market segment across the globe.

Boohoo employees enjoy a variety of benefits, including pension plans and bonus schemes. The company focuses on employee health with gyms on-site and free health cash plans and mental support. The company is well-known for its commitment towards size inclusivity. It offers detailed clothing size charts to help shoppers find the right fit.
